When attempting to run these two massive modifications simultaneously without a compatibility layer, players often encounter frustrating logical conflicts. Create operates on standard Minecraft block states and simplified crafting logic, whereas TerraFirmaCraft completely overhauls metallurgy, temperature mechanics, and item interactions. Without intervention, automated drills might fail to harvest charcoal piles correctly, or mechanical arms may ignore crucial crucibles. This mod resolves those discrepancies, ensuring that every gear turn respects the underlying physics of the TFC world. Core Compatibility Features and Mechanics

The primary value proposition of this module lies in its targeted fixes for specific interaction points between the two parent mods. Rather than attempting to rewrite entire systems, it focuses on the friction points where automation usually fails in a TFC environment. The following features represent the current functional scope of the mod:

  • Drill Interaction with Charcoal Piles: In a vanilla Create setup, mechanical drills often struggle with custom block states. This mod ensures that Create drills can properly break down charcoal piles, yielding the correct amount of charcoal based on TFC mechanics. This prevents resource loss and eliminates the need for manual harvesting in large-scale production lines.
  • Bloom Processing Automation: Similar to charcoal, the extraction of blooms from bloomeries is now fully compatible with mechanical drilling. The mod ensures that the drop rates and item types match the expectations set by TerraFirmaCraft, maintaining the integrity of the metal progression tree.
  • Mechanical Arm Targeting: One of the most significant upgrades is the ability for Create mechanical arms to recognize and interact with TFC-specific blocks. Crucibles and charcoal forges are now valid targets for item insertion and extraction. This opens up sophisticated logistics networks where raw ore can be automatically fed into a crucible, melted, and cast without player intervention.
  • Thermodynamic Basin Heating: Perhaps the most innovative feature is the linking of TFC heat sources to Create basins. The mod allows a charcoal forge to act as a valid heat source for a Create basin situated above or adjacent to it. This means players can utilize traditional TFC fire management to power industrial mixing and alloying processes.
  • Advanced Temperature Logic: The basins do not just accept heat; they respect TFC temperature tiers. The system differentiates between standard heating and "white hot" super-heating states, reflecting the complex thermodynamics that TFC veterans rely on for high-tier alloy creation.
  • JEI Recipe Transparency: To prevent confusion during crafting, the mod updates Just Enough Items (JEI) tooltips. Recipes involving basins now explicitly display requirements for charcoal forges and specific TFC heat levels, ensuring players understand why a recipe might fail if the thermal conditions are not met.

Technical Specifications and Version Support

For server administrators and modpack developers, technical stability is paramount. TFC Create: Bridging TerraFirmaCraft and Create Automation is currently built to support specific versions of Minecraft that host both parent modifications. While the mod is actively under development, it generally targets the 1.18.2 and 1.19.2 ecosystems, depending on the release cycles of TerraFirmaCraft and Create. It requires the Forge mod loader to function, as both underlying mods rely on Forge's extensive API for block registration and event handling.

It is important to note that this module was originally architected with the SeriousFirmaCraft modpack in mind. Consequently, some balancing decisions regarding heat transfer rates or machine speeds may feel tuned specifically for that environment. When integrating this into a custom modpack, users should be prepared to tweak configuration files to match their desired difficulty curve. The developer community is actively testing various scenarios, but unexpected behaviors can occur when mixed with other technology mods that also alter crafting tables or fluid dynamics.

Implementation Strategies and Usage Scenarios

Successfully deploying this mod requires a shift in factory design philosophy. In a standard Create world, heat is often abstracted or provided by simple lava sources. In a TFC-integrated world, heat becomes a managed resource. Players must design their facilities to accommodate charcoal forges as the heart of their thermal processing units. A typical efficient setup involves placing a charcoal forge beneath a sequence of basins, using mechanical arms to feed ore and flux into the basins while the forge provides the necessary thermal energy.
